  4. DNA: Double Stranded (double helix) Thymine Deoxyribose Stores genetic info RNA: Single Stranded Uracil Ribose Involved in protein synthesis Both: Nucleic Acids Adenine, Guanine, Cytosine Phosphates Sugar
